Backpacking is a fantastic way to connect with nature and experience the great outdoors. Whether you're a complete novice or have experimented with light treks before, the United States offers a treasure trove of stunning trails perfect for fresh faces.
- Before you hit your first backpacking trip, it's essential to pack the essential gear. This covers a sturdy backpack, comfortable boots, a reliable tent, a sleeping bag appropriate for the weather conditions, and a map or GPS device to steer you on your way.
- Opting for a suitable trail is crucial. Start with shorter, easier trails and gradually work your way up the difficulty as your experience grows. Always study the trail conditions beforehand and check weather forecasts to guarantee a safe and enjoyable trip.
- Leave no trace by packing out all trash, staying on designated trails, and respecting wildlife. Let someone know your itinerary and expected return time before you set off.
With a little forethought, backpacking can be an incredibly rewarding experience. So, grab your gear, hit the trails, and discover the beauty of the great outdoors!
